The
Bandidos Motorcycle Club, like other prominent
outlaw motorcycle clubs, utilizes smaller motorcycle clubs – known as
support clubs, "puppet clubs" or "satellite clubs" – as auxiliary units. These support clubs, mostly regional, are subservient to the will of the Bandidos and, in general, are typically used for protection, promotion or financing, but can also be used to facilitate criminal activities such as drug trafficking, extortion, assault and murder.[1][2]
The coalition of Bandidos support clubs and the Bandidos MC are often collectively referred to as the "Red and Gold Family" as well as the "Red and Gold Nation". It is common for the logos and insignia of these groups to bear the Bandidos colors in reverse (gold on red) , which can be seen on their patches and insignia.[3]
International
Caballeros MC – Active in the United Kingdom and Germany.
Cazador MC – Active in the United States and Indonesia.
Chicanos MC – Active in Germany, the Netherlands, Norway, Russia, Serbia, Sweden, Ukraine, and the United Arab Emirates.
Diablos MC – Active in Australia, Belgium, Finland, Germany, Indonesia, Kazakhstan, Laos, Singapore, Sweden, Thailand, Ukraine and the United Arab Emirates.
Harami (Haramy) MC – Active in Germany and Turkey.[4][5]
Hermanos MC – Active in Germany and the United States.[6][7]
Imperator MC – Active in the United States and Norway.
Leones MC – Active in Finland and Thailand.
Pistoleros MC – Active in the United States, France and England.[8][9]
Predadores MC – Active in Thailand and Belgium.
X-Team – Active in Denmark, Finland, Germany, Norway, Sweden and Brunei.[10][11]
